public class AlignmentModelChangeAdapter extends java.lang.Object implements AlignmentModelChangeListener
AlignmentModelChangeListener.
Anonymous listener implementations that only need to overwrite one or a few method can be inherited from this class to reduce the necessary amount of code.
| Constructor and Description |
|---|
AlignmentModelChangeAdapter() |
| Modifier and Type | Method and Description |
|---|---|
<T,U> void |
afterModelChanged(AlignmentModel<T> previous,
AlignmentModel<U> current)
Called if this listener was moved to another instance of
AlignmentModel. |
<T> void |
afterSequenceChange(SequenceChangeEvent<T> e)
Called after a sequence has been inserted, removed or replaced.
|
<T> void |
afterSequenceRenamed(SequenceRenamedEvent<T> e)
Called after a sequence was renamed.
|
<T> void |
afterTokenChange(TokenChangeEvent<T> e)
Called after a single token or a set of tokens has been inserted, removed or replaced.
|
public AlignmentModelChangeAdapter()
public <T> void afterSequenceChange(SequenceChangeEvent<T> e)
AlignmentModelChangeListenerafterSequenceChange in interface AlignmentModelChangeListenere - the event object containing information on the changepublic <T> void afterSequenceRenamed(SequenceRenamedEvent<T> e)
AlignmentModelChangeListenerafterSequenceRenamed in interface AlignmentModelChangeListenere - the event object containing information on the changepublic <T> void afterTokenChange(TokenChangeEvent<T> e)
AlignmentModelChangeListenerafterTokenChange in interface AlignmentModelChangeListenere - the event object containing information on the changepublic <T,U> void afterModelChanged(AlignmentModel<T> previous, AlignmentModel<U> current)
AlignmentModelChangeListenerAlignmentModel.
This happens if the alignment model of an AlignmentArea was changed.
afterModelChanged in interface AlignmentModelChangeListenerprevious - the alignment model this listener was attached to before the event happenedcurrent - the new alignment model this listener is attached to now